Output 2691e34b5da19094741bf639b4f2f579c5cb30cb3ee09b4aefdde2004c083333:6

value
194195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853ecd875209aa866ba8f1de0dddfd4cf8380159 OP_EQUAL
address
3DqZ2g8SxdodkX58QufDo2jHZ4Rf8XM3ca
transaction
2691e34b5da19094741bf639b4f2f579c5cb30cb3ee09b4aefdde2004c083333
confirmations
287610
spent
true